G.J. Gyapong is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ics and Radiation. According to data from OpenAlex, G.J. Gyapong has authored 28 papers receiving a total of 350 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Nuclear and High Energy Physics, 18 papers in Atomic and Molecular Physics, and Optics and 14 papers in Radiation. Recurrent topics in G.J. Gyapong’s work include Nuclear physics research studies (24 papers), Atomic and Molecular Physics (14 papers) and Nuclear Physics and Applications (12 papers). G.J. Gyapong is often cited by papers focused on Nuclear physics research studies (24 papers), Atomic and Molecular Physics (14 papers) and Nuclear Physics and Applications (12 papers). G.J. Gyapong collaborates with scholars based in United Kingdom, Australia and United States. G.J. Gyapong's co-authors include R.H. Spear, M. P. Fewell, D. L. Watson, Benjamin J. Fulton, A.M. Baxter, C. D. Jones, W. D. M. Rae, M. Freer, M. J. Leddy and W. N. Catford and has published in prestigious journals such as Physics Letters B, Nuclear Physics A and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ment.
